Could it be head lice?
One of the first possibilities parents think about is head lice.
Head lice are tiny parasitic insects that live on the human scalp and feed on blood. They are particularly common among school-aged children.
According to the CDC, head lice are spread primarily through direct hair-to-hair contact. They do not jump or fly. (cdc.gov)
This is an important distinction because many myths surround head lice.
Children don't get head lice because they are dirty.
Head lice can affect people regardless of personal hygiene, household cleanliness or socioeconomic circumstances.
A child can pick them up simply by having close head-to-head contact with another person who has them.
What do head lice look like?
Adult head lice are small insects, typically about the size of a sesame seed. Their eggs, commonly called nits, are much smaller and are attached firmly to individual hairs close to the scalp. (cdc.gov)
Because they are so small, identification can be difficult.
A parent looking at a photograph may mistake:
A louse for another insect
A nit for dandruff
A piece of lint for an egg
A scab for an insect
A harmless insect for a louse
One useful clue is attachment.
Nits are firmly attached to the hair shaft. Dandruff and ordinary flakes are generally much easier to brush or shake away.
Adult lice, meanwhile, move.
If you see a tiny insect crawling through the hair, head lice are one possibility—but not the only one.
Itching is common, but not guaranteed
A common symptom of head lice is itching.
The itching occurs because of an allergic reaction to the bites, according to the CDC. However, a person may not experience itching immediately after becoming infested. (cdc.gov)
That means:
No itching does not automatically rule out lice.
Likewise, itching doesn't prove that lice are present.
Other scalp conditions can cause itching, including dandruff, eczema, allergic reactions and irritation from hair products.
If you suspect head lice, look carefully rather than relying on symptoms alone.
Could it be a tick?
Another important possibility is a tick.
Ticks are not insects in the biological sense. They are arachnids, related to spiders and mites.
A tick can end up on a child's scalp after outdoor exposure, particularly in areas where ticks are common.
Unlike a louse, a tick may attach firmly to the skin and feed over an extended period.
If you find an object attached to your child's scalp and suspect it is a tick, don't simply assume it will fall off on its own.
Prompt removal is generally recommended.
The CDC recommends removing an attached tick as soon as possible using fine-tipped tweezers. The tick should be grasped close to the skin and pulled upward with steady, even pressure. (cdc.gov)
Avoid twisting or jerking the tick.
Do not cover it with petroleum jelly, nail polish or other substances in an attempt to make it detach. The CDC specifically advises against methods such as burning or suffocating an attached tick. (cdc.gov)
Why tick identification matters
Ticks can transmit certain infections.
The specific risks depend heavily on the tick species and geographic location.
Not every tick carries disease, and not every tick bite results in illness. But identifying the exposure can help healthcare professionals assess whether follow-up is appropriate.
After removing a tick, note:
The date of the bite or discovery
Where the child was when exposure may have occurred
How long the tick may have been attached, if known
Whether the tick appeared swollen or engorged
Any symptoms that develop afterward
If you are uncertain whether the organism was a tick, save it in a sealed container or take a clear photograph if doing so is safe and practical. A local healthcare professional or qualified identification service may be able to help.
What if it isn't attached?
This is an important clue.
Suppose you discover a small insect moving through your child's hair, but it isn't attached to the scalp.
That could point away from a tick.
It also doesn't automatically mean head lice.
Many insects can accidentally become trapped in hair after a child plays outside.
A small beetle, fly, aphid, ant or other arthropod could potentially become caught in someone's hair without establishing an infestation.
This is why location alone isn't enough for identification.
An insect on a child's head is not necessarily an insect that lives on a child's head.
Look at the whole picture
When trying to understand an unfamiliar insect, don't focus only on its color.
Color can change depending on lighting, camera quality, age of the insect and whether it has recently fed.
Instead, look for several characteristics.
Size
How large is the insect compared with a hair, fingertip or common object?
Shape
Is the body long and narrow, oval, flattened or rounded?
Number of legs
Is it an insect with six legs, or could it be a tick or mite with eight?
Wings
Does it have visible wings?
Movement
Does it crawl, jump, fly or remain attached?
Location
Is it moving through the hair, attached directly to the scalp, or found only on clothing?
Quantity
Did you find one organism or several?
Attachment
Is something firmly attached to the hair shaft or skin?
These clues are often more useful than simply saying that the creature is "brown" or "black."

Avoid household insecticides on your child's scalp
This is one of the most important safety points.
If you're uncertain what you found, don't grab a household insect spray and apply it to your child's hair or skin.
Products designed to kill insects around the home are not automatically safe for human skin.
The same applies to agricultural pesticides, pet flea treatments and other products not specifically intended for children.
A child's scalp can absorb chemicals, and accidental exposure can cause irritation or poisoning.
If you believe your child has head lice, use a treatment specifically designed and labeled for head lice and follow its instructions carefully. When in doubt, ask a pediatrician or pharmacist.
What if you think it is head lice?
If you identify a live head louse, the CDC recommends treating the infestation with an appropriate head-lice treatment and following the product instructions. (cdc.gov)
Treatment isn't simply about killing one insect.
You also need to check the child's hair carefully for additional lice and nits.
The CDC notes that nits found more than about a quarter-inch from the scalp are often unlikely to hatch or may be empty, while eggs close to the scalp deserve more attention. (cdc.gov)
Fine-toothed lice combs can be useful for removing lice and nits.
Follow the treatment instructions precisely.
Some products require a second treatment because the first application may not kill all eggs.
Don't treat the whole family automatically
If one child has head lice, it can be tempting to immediately apply treatment to every member of the household.
That isn't necessarily necessary.
The CDC recommends checking household members and close contacts and treating people who have live lice or nits close to the scalp according to appropriate guidance. (cdc.gov)
The important thing is to inspect carefully rather than treating everyone indiscriminately.
Overusing lice treatments can expose people to unnecessary chemicals without solving the underlying problem.
Head lice don't mean your home is dirty
This myth deserves special attention.
Head lice aren't a sign that a child or family is unclean.
The CDC explains that head lice spread primarily through direct hair-to-hair contact. (cdc.gov)
Lice don't care whether a home is spotless.
They care about finding a suitable human host.
This matters because embarrassment can prevent parents from telling schools, relatives or other parents about an infestation.
There's no reason for shame.
Head lice are a common parasitic infestation, particularly among children, and the appropriate response is practical treatment and prevention of further spread.
What about sharing hats and brushes?
Parents often assume that lice are primarily spread through hats, brushes and pillows.
The CDC says transmission through objects such as clothing, combs or bedding is much less common than direct hair-to-hair contact. (cdc.gov)
That doesn't mean you should deliberately share personal hairbrushes.
It's simply important to understand the main route of transmission.
If your child has lice, avoid direct head-to-head contact and follow appropriate treatment and cleaning guidance.
There is no need to panic-clean the entire house.

What if you find a tick on the scalp?
Don't panic.
The important thing is to remove it properly.
Use fine-tipped tweezers and grasp the tick as close to the skin as possible. Pull upward slowly and steadily. After removal, clean the bite area and your hands. The CDC recommends these steps for attached ticks. (cdc.gov)
If mouthparts remain in the skin, the CDC notes that they can sometimes be left alone if they cannot easily be removed with tweezers; the skin may eventually expel them. (cdc.gov)
Don't crush the tick with your bare fingers.
If possible, keep the tick in a sealed container or take a photograph for identification.
Watch for symptoms after a tick bite
After a known tick bite, monitor the child for symptoms.
Depending on the infection and geographic area, symptoms can include fever, fatigue, headache, muscle aches or a rash.
A rash associated with Lyme disease, for example, may appear days to weeks after a bite, although not everyone develops the classic expanding rash.
If your child develops symptoms after a tick bite, contact a healthcare professional and mention the tick exposure.
The doctor can consider the child's age, location, timing, symptoms and the type of tick exposure.
When should you call a doctor?
Contact your child's healthcare professional if:
You cannot identify an attached organism.
You suspect a tick was attached.
Your child develops a rash after an insect bite.
Your child develops fever or appears unwell.
The bite becomes increasingly red, painful, swollen or warm.
There is pus or another sign of infection.
Your child develops widespread hives.
Your child has persistent or severe itching.
You suspect a parasitic infestation but aren't sure how to treat it.
A healthcare professional can determine whether the problem requires treatment, observation or simple reassurance.
When is it an emergency?
Most insect encounters are not emergencies.
However, some reactions can be.
Call emergency services immediately if your child develops signs of a severe allergic reaction after an insect bite or sting, such as:
Difficulty breathing
Swelling of the lips, tongue or throat
Severe wheezing
Fainting
Extreme weakness
Widespread hives accompanied by breathing or circulation problems
A severe allergic reaction can progress quickly and requires emergency treatment.
Likewise, if your child is very ill after a suspected tick exposure or develops concerning neurological symptoms, seek urgent medical care.
